As nouns the difference between moa and kiwi

is that moa is a very large, extinct, flightless bird of the family Dinornithidae that was native to New Zealand; until its extinction, one species was the largest bird in the world while kiwi is a flightless bird of the genus Apteryx native to New Zealand.

  • A flightless bird of the genus Apteryx native to New Zealand.
  • (person from New Zealand).
  • A New Zealand dollar.
  • A kiwi fruit.
  • Usage notes

    * When used to describe people, Kiwi is usually capitalised. * The plural is usually kiwis''; sometimes, ''kiwi is found as an (invariant) plural form.
